India’s startup ecosystem is undergoing a remarkable transformation, evolving into a hub of meaningful innovation that directly impacts millions. No longer confined to abstract solutions, today’s entrepreneurs are harnessing technology to tackle real-world challenges in areas such as financial fraud, paediatric healthcare, and road safety. This shift was evident in a recent episode of Zerodha co-founder Nikhil Kamath’s WTFund podcast, where he spotlighted some of the most inspiring ventures driving this change.
One such startup making waves is Modus AI, which is addressing the persistent threat of financial fraud in India’s rapidly expanding fintech landscape. Leveraging advanced generative AI, Modus AI has developed a sophisticated fraud detection system that automates the identification of red flags for banks and payment aggregators. In an era where scams involving mule accounts, fraudulent merchant setups, and fake transactions have become increasingly rampant, the company’s innovative approach is redefining financial security. With pilots already in place with financial institutions and discussions underway with major e-commerce players to curb return scams, Modus AI is pioneering a real-time, lifetime monitoring system that builds graph infrastructure to track and identify fraudulent linkages—an entirely novel concept in the Indian market.
In the domain of paediatric healthcare, AI.gnosis is revolutionising early childhood development diagnostics through artificial intelligence. Conditions such as autism and other neurodivergent tendencies often go unnoticed in their early stages, leading to missed opportunities for timely intervention. AI.gnosis is changing that narrative with a groundbreaking five-minute AI-powered tool that analyses biomarkers like eye movements and facial expressions to generate a developmental harmony score. Deployed in preschools and paediatric clinics, this tool enables early detection of neurodivergent behaviour, offering a scalable and accessible solution for parents and healthcare providers. With autism rates climbing post-COVID, AI.gnosis is positioning itself as a leader in paediatric healthcare innovation, seeking institutional partners to expand its impact and set new benchmarks in developmental assessments.
Road safety is another critical issue in India, where two-wheelers account for over 60% of traffic accidents. BYTES is stepping up to address this crisis by making Advanced Driver Assistance Systems (ADAS) technology accessible to motorbike users. Traditionally limited to high-end cars, these safety features—such as collision alerts and skid control—are now being tailored for two-wheelers at an affordable price point. The company has already initiated pilot projects with major original equipment manufacturers (OEMs) like Hero and Honda, working to integrate its technology into mainstream vehicle manufacturing. To accelerate its mission, BYTES is raising $500,000 in pre-seed funding, with half already committed, as it prepares to expand its pilots and explore markets like Indonesia, where similar road safety challenges persist.
